Output 507a57563aea1613aa8d35efdda0ec51a7aacdf89608b0f1958c8b5b167d0c9c:1

value
217599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7448abb8e1aae05a6ded0dcb5f5af29d81ef1eb4 OP_EQUAL
address
3CHsN3v5fw9wGP9hukyiojThRcUoNzcC8i
transaction
507a57563aea1613aa8d35efdda0ec51a7aacdf89608b0f1958c8b5b167d0c9c
confirmations
113638
spent
true